  • Publication number: 20240125500
    Abstract: A monitoring system is configured to monitor an environment within an enclosure of a heating, ventilation, air conditioning, and/or refrigeration (HVAC&R) system. The monitoring system includes a sensor configured to acquire data indicative of an environmental parameter value within the enclosure. The monitoring system also includes a controller configured to receive the data from the sensor, to determine occurrence of a thermal event within the enclosure based on the data, and to instruct a circuit breaker of the HVAC&R system to transition to a fault configuration in response to determining the occurrence of the thermal event.

  • Patent number: 6245127
    Abstract: A low pressure swing adsorption process and apparatus for the recovery of carbon dioxide from multi-component gas mixtures, utilizing the simultaneous purge and evacuation of opposite ends of the adsorber(s) to effect controlled depressurization in the adsorber bed(s) to maintain the constant purity of a carbon dioxide-enriched product stream recovered from the adsorber inlet(s).

  • Patent number: 6027548
    Abstract: The invention comprises a PSA apparatus for the separation of a heavy component from a light component in a feed stream. The apparatus includes an adsorbent bed comprising either a mixture of adsorbents or composite adsorbent particles wherein each particle comprises two or more adsorbents. At least one of the adsorbents is comparatively weak and the other is comparatively strong. Another embodiment of the invention is a PSA prepurifier having a bed of adsorbent material which comprises a mixture of, or composite adsorbent particles wherein each particle comprises at least two adsorbents, at least one of the adsorbents being comparatively strong and at least another of the adsorbents being comparatively weak.
